Output 87bbdd5e89e2f90741c05eb98cff8edb6c8f942ae016f19c25e6c8091c5f054e:1

value
170621718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666dfc641f1ea9388edbe0d3fd1267b9fcd193eb OP_EQUAL
address
3B2cc4ikP2QfBhj3F2GPv3X1snxKeK5Kk2
transaction
87bbdd5e89e2f90741c05eb98cff8edb6c8f942ae016f19c25e6c8091c5f054e
confirmations
18512
spent
true